Colonel Borst ( second from right), commander of the German pocket at Lorient on the Atlantic coast of France, signs the unconditional surrender of the German troops in the pocket on May 7, 1945 at Belz (France). At left, are Colonel Gavin and Colonel John Keating of the 66th U.S. Division and a French officer.
